Glass Wealth Management Co LLC Has $5.32 Million Stock Holdings in Morgan Stanley $MS

Glass Wealth Management Co LLC grew its position in Morgan Stanley (NYSE:MSFree Report) by 9.7% during the 4th quarter, according to the company in its most recent disclosure with the SEC. The firm owned 29,969 shares of the financial services provider’s stock after purchasing an additional 2,643 shares during the period. Morgan Stanley comprises about 2.2% of Glass Wealth Management Co LLC’s portfolio, making the stock its 14th largest position. Glass Wealth Management Co LLC’s holdings in Morgan Stanley were worth $5,320,000 at the end of the most recent reporting period.

Morgan Stanley Stock Down 1.1%

Shares of MS stock opened at $190.89 on Tuesday. The company has a current ratio of 0.77, a quick ratio of 0.77 and a debt-to-equity ratio of 3.52. Morgan Stanley has a 1 year low of $123.88 and a 1 year high of $194.83. The firm’s fifty day moving average price is $173.41 and its two-hundred day moving average price is $174.08. The firm has a market capitalization of $301.08 billion, a P/E ratio of 17.29, a PEG ratio of 1.45 and a beta of 1.22.

Morgan Stanley (NYSE:MSGet Free Report) last issued its quarterly earnings results on Wednesday, April 15th. The financial services provider reported $3.43 ear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, beating the consensus estimate of $3.02 by $0.41. The firm had revenue of $20.58 billion for the quarter, compared to analyst estimates of $19.23 billion. Morgan Stanley had a net margin of 14.65% and a return on equity of 17.70%. The company’s revenue was up 16.0% compared to the same quarter last year. During the same period in the previous year, the business earned $2.60 EPS. On average, equities analysts predict that Morgan Stanley will post 11.85 EPS for the current fiscal year.

Morgan Stanley Announces Dividend

The company also recently disclosed a quarterly dividend, which will be paid on Friday, May 15th. Stockholders of record on Thursday, April 30th will be paid a dividend of $1.00 per share. The ex-dividend date is Thursday, April 30th. This represents a $4.00 annualized dividend and a dividend yield of 2.1%. Morgan Stanley’s payout ratio is currently 36.23%.

About Morgan Stanley

(Free Report)

Morgan Stanley (NYSE: MS) is a global financial services firm headquartered in New York City. Founded in 1935 by Henry S. Morgan and Harold Stanley, the company provides a broad range of investment banking, securities, wealth management and investment management services to corporations, governments, institutions and individual investors. Leadership has been guided by a senior executive team and board of directors; James P. Gorman has served as the company’s chief executive and chairman in recent years.

The firm’s primary business activities are organized around three principal businesses: Institutional Securities, Wealth Management and Investment Management.
